Pakistan People's Party (PPP) senior leader Manzoor Hussain Wassan said there are 50 per cent chance of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) in scheduled general elections on Feb 08, 2024.
According to the 24News HD TV channel, he talked to the media on his son's birthday on Sunday and said he has dreamed that the elections will be held on February 8.
He said the new year will be better than 2023 for the country and politics and it will also prove to be good for the country's economy and law and order situation.
Wassan said in the year 2024, politicians and the establishment will no longer repeat old mistakes and the prime minister will be Bilawal Bhutto or Nawaz Sharif in the upcoming election.
He said there will be no alliance or seat adjustment between PPP and PML-N, but the competition in the election will be tough.
He said Maulana Fazlur Rehman is a good man but he will not be the President of the country but could become the head of the Kashmir Committee again.
